# Brightmoor Relay — Environments

Brightmoor Relay runs in three environments: dev, staging, and prod. The websocket reconnect bug (clients stuck in a retry loop after idle timeout) only reproduces in staging because its load balancer drops idle connections after 60 seconds, while dev uses direct connections. Prod has the fix flag enabled since the Pellworth release. If you need to reproduce the bug locally, mirror the staging setup, whose active configuration values are listed below.

config for faduf-fahip:
ELIAX_LOG_LEVEL=error
ELIAX_METRICS_HOST=metrics.eliax.zemvarcorp.corp
ELIAX_POOL_SIZE=16

Quarterly Planning Note — Divestiture of the Coastal Tooling Unit

For the finance team: the sale of the Coastal Tooling unit to Pellmark Industries remains on track for close in Q3. Please finalize the carve-out balance sheet, reconcile intercompany positions, and prepare the working-capital adjustment schedule by month-end. Audit support requests should be prioritized. For planning purposes, note the following sensitive item:

internal memo for hawef-kahif: The finance team signed off on a budget of $25.9 million for Project Sorox. The renewal with Pelokek Logistics closes at $51.7 million a year, 52 percent below the last contract.

Handover: the Tallygrove formula sandbox now runs user expressions in an isolated interpreter with a 50ms budget and no filesystem access. Remaining work is denying recursive imports and fuzzing the parser. Tests live under sandbox/spec. Please review the allowlist changes carefully. Questions about the isolation model should go to the engineer who owns it.

account owner for bawip-tahag: Raleth Quenok